I think everything you're saying is fair! I have AROSS, but only because I got the Vl. 1 and Cello for 50% off and then tested extensively before deciding to add the rest at the bundle price. I wasn't prepared to pay the full bundle price. I did exactly the tests you did - CSS, Afflatus and SSO - and only decided to complete AROSS because of how uniquely easy it is to play. I simply don't have ONE other library that offers that workflow at that high quality level. I have a patch here and patch there from other libraries that can do individual things better, but they also have their quirks, problems and shortcomings in sound quality, workflow or flexibility. For example, I was playing with CSS today and noticed that the portamenti are baked in with no round robins. If there's a slide between two notes, it will be there EVERY TIME you play them, whether you want it or not. I want more control than that. In Afflatus, I paid for a lot of sound design stuff I'll never use and the full price is just as crazy as AROSS for less impressive recording quality. SSO is a great deal, but AIR is very wet in a cinematic way and not as flexible as Abbey Road for the shaping of concert sound. In that sense, for me, those aren't Holy Grail libraries either. That library still doesn't exist, so I have many diversely able/flawed libraries at my disposal and I've found time and time again, that having the right tool quickly when I need it on a deadline is worth quite a lot of money to me. I make the money spent back in time saved. AROSS is not a library to buy as a hobby accessory or even as a pro tool at the full price. At a significant discount - only just, but I got there. As you say, everybody needs to know what provides value at what price and act based on that.

I have recently being talking to support over jumps in volume on the strings in the Albion Colossus library. I thought it was either a bug in my installation or something on their radar to fix. Got absoutely nowhere after providing lots of audio examples and the response was that's how it's supposed to be. But the jumps in volume between notes are so noticeable and like the examples you've shown with this far more expensive library all needs correcting in the DAW once recorded in. The older libraries I've bought from them have been wonderful, but will think long and hard about investing any more as it's just sloppy and as you say in this case erodes the illustion that this is a premium product..
